E-COM-NET
首页
在线工具
Layui镜像站
SUI文档
联系我们
推荐频道
Java
PHP
C++
C
C#
Python
Ruby
go语言
Scala
Servlet
Vue
MySQL
NoSQL
Redis
CSS
Oracle
SQL Server
DB2
HBase
Http
HTML5
Spring
Ajax
Jquery
JavaScript
Json
XML
NodeJs
mybatis
Hibernate
算法
设计模式
shell
数据结构
大数据
JS
消息中间件
正则表达式
Tomcat
SQL
Nginx
Shiro
Maven
Linux
LAST_VALUE
DAX之LOOKUPVALUE函数
前文我们看到,
LAST_VALUE
函数的使用,那么,DAX如何使用呢?这里引入LOOKUPVALUE函数,同样非常简单。
iteye_4537
·
2020-09-12 19:26
Oracle中的分析函数over()的详细解析
1.1rank()/dense_rank()1.1.1基础1.1.2示例1.2min()/max()1.2.1示例1.3lead()/lag()1.3.1基础1.3.2示例1.4FIRST_VALUE/
LAST_VALUE
上善若泪
·
2020-09-10 23:51
Oracle
SQL FIRST_VALUE() 获取分组排序后的最前条记录
有如下几种函数用法,first_value,
last_value
,Nth_valuePartitionBy是指按照什么项目分组,ORDERBY这个不用解释了。
大爷编程奋斗记
·
2020-08-26 14:24
SQL
FIRST_VALUE
OVER
PARTITION
分析
Hive常用函数大全(窗口函数、分析函数)
1、相关函数1.1窗口函数FIRST_VALUE:取分组内排序后,截止到当前行,第一个值
LAST_VALUE
:取分组内排序后,截止到当前行,最后一个值LEAD(col,n,DEFAULT):用于统计窗口内往后第
hyunbar
·
2020-08-25 16:33
使用ROWNUM做分页查询,页码,数据总条数错误问题
.*,ROWNUMROWNO,
last_value
(ROWNUM)over()astotalfrom(selectA.
波波Tang
·
2020-08-18 16:53
SQL
分页
sql 中的导航函数 FIRST_VALUE,
LAST_VALUE
FIRST_VALUE以下示例计算各部门的最快时间,并且计算某个部门么每个员工与第一名的时间差WITHfinishersAS(SELECT'SophiaLiu'asname,TIMESTAMP'2016-10-182:51:45'asfinish_time,'F30-34'asdivisionUNIONALLSELECT'LisaStelzner',TIMESTAMP'2016-10-182:54
luoganttcc
·
2020-08-18 15:41
sql
PostgreSQL 名称解释l bookindex
lag,窗口函数language_handler,伪类型largeobject,大对象lastval,序列操作函数
last_value
,窗口函数LATERAL,LATERAL子查询在FROM子句中,LATERAL
灵魂小人物
·
2020-08-10 07:16
数据库
PostgreSQL
sql
数据库
postgresql
Hive开窗函数
last_value
、lead、lag、row_number、rank、dense等
1、求截止到当前行不为空最后一个值selectcalendar_day,if_trade_dt,mkt_code,
last_value
(tmp_trade_dt,true)over(partitionbymkt_codeorderbycalendar_daydesc
天马行空KY
·
2020-08-07 10:27
hive
【Hive】Hive窗口函数
语法概括:Function()Over(PartitionByColumn1,Column2,OrderByColumn3)FIRST_VALUE(col),
LAST_VALUE
(col)可以返回窗口帧
无影风Victorz
·
2020-08-03 06:08
Hive
SQL Server Window函数
LAST_VALUE
获取结果集的有序分
苏小淇
·
2020-07-30 07:07
SQL
SQLServer
Oracle返回结果集中任意一行的字段值——NTH_VALUE
之前就一直知道分析函数有First_value和
Last_value
,可以分别返回第一笔和最后一笔的值,抑或者用row_number/rank/dense_rank再包一层取任意一行的值。
小德
·
2020-07-29 00:27
其他技术
数据库相关
Greenplum实现nulls first/last改写
而在Greenplum之前的版本中是不支持这种写法的:select*fromtblorderbyidnullsfirst;selectid,
last_value
(key)over(partitionbygidorderbycrt_timenullsfirst
foucus、
·
2020-07-28 20:25
Greenplum
Oracle 11g r2分析函数新特性(一)
以前版本的分析函数,提供了FIRST_VALUE和
LAST_VALUE
的功能,而11gr2中,Oracle增加了一个NTH_VALUE的功能,这个功能包含了FIRST_VALUE和
LAST_VALUE
的功能
weixin_34368949
·
2020-07-28 19:43
PostgreSQL主从序列的
last_value
不一致
为什么80%的码农都做不了架构师?>>>一直以为PostgreSQL的主从所有数据都是一致的,但直到最近测试过程中发现的一个奇怪的序列问题让我有所改观,一开始以为是某个版本的问题,发现9.x的版本都存在这个问题,让我一度认为是postgresql的一个BUG。我们的一个应用会定期同步PostgreSQL流复制的从机数据到一台测试机上,此时测试机上的数据和生产的现存数据是一致的,但是序列的last_
weixin_33805557
·
2020-07-28 17:57
hive 取两次记录的时间差 lead lag first_value
last_value
--LEAD(col,n,DEFAULT)用于统计窗口内往下第n行值--第一个参数为列名,第二个参数为往下第n行(可选,默认为1),第三个参数为默认值(当往下第n行为NULL时候,取默认值,如不指定,则为NULL)--LAG(col,n,DEFAULT)用于统计窗口内往上第n行值--第一个参数为列名,第二个参数为往上第n行(可选,默认为1),第三个参数为默认值(当往上第n行为NULL时候,取默认值
weixin_30835933
·
2020-07-28 17:11
大数据
mysql查询-窗口函数
percent_rank()、cume_dist()与rank()有关5.nfile(N)、nth_value(expr,N)6.lag(expr,N)/lead(expr,N)7.first_value(expr)、
last_value
Ares82219102
·
2020-07-28 06:18
数据库
Oracle分析函数之first()和last()函数
selectdeptno,
last_value
(sal)over(orderbydeptno)first_sal,salfromemp;--orderby分组有效selectdeptno,first_value
一个阳光努力的程序盐
·
2020-07-28 06:17
Oracle之分析函数
Oracle分析函数-first_value()和
last_value
()
rst_value()和
last_value
()字面意思已经很直观了,取首尾记录值。
qq_27997957
·
2020-07-28 06:38
hive_取两次记录的时间差lead/lag/first_value/
last_value
函数使用 及用户在各个页面停留时间计算示例
这几个函数不支持WINDOW子句1)LEAD(col,n,DEFAULT)用于统计窗口内往下第n行值--第一个参数为列名,第二个参数为往下第n行(可选,默认为1),第三个参数为默认值(当往下第n行为NULL时候,取默认值,如不指定,则为NULL)2)LAG(col,n,DEFAULT)用于统计窗口内往上第n行值--第一个参数为列名,第二个参数为往上第n行(可选,默认为1),第三个参数为默认值(当往
数仓大山哥
·
2020-07-28 02:42
hive
SQL SERVER中FIRST_VALUE和
LAST_VALUE
SQLSERVER中FIRST_VALUE和LAST_VALUEFIRST_VALUE和
LAST_VALUE
看下组SQL语句:WITHtestas(select'乐可乐可的部落格'asname,10asscoreUNIONALLselect
DePaul
·
2020-07-28 02:26
SQL
Server
Hive分析窗口函数 LAG,LEAD,FIRST_VALUE,
LAST_VALUE
转自:http://lxw1234.com/archives/2015/04/190.htm数据准备:cookie1,2015-04-1010:00:02,url2cookie1,2015-04-1010:00:00,url1cookie1,2015-04-1010:03:04,1url3cookie1,2015-04-1010:50:05,url6cookie1,2015-04-1011:00:
卡奥斯道
·
2020-07-28 01:59
hive
oracle 分析函数之first_value和
last_value
first_value函数返回结果集中排在第一位的值语法:first_value(expression)over(partition-clauseorder-by-clausewindowing-clause)建表语句:createtableSMALL_CUSTOMERS(CUSTOMER_IDNUMBER,SUM_ORDERSNUMBER);insertintoSMALL_CUSTOMERS(C
iteye_15396
·
2020-07-28 00:30
oracle基础
Oracle分析函数总结(2) - 排序 - rank,dense_rank,row_number,first,first_value,last,
last_value
,lag,lead
分析函数的基本概念和语法->http://blog.csdn.net/fw0124/article/details/78420391)rank(),dense_rank(),row_number()这几个函数区别是:a)rank()是跳跃排序,有两个第1名时接下来就是第3名;b)dense_rank()是连续排序,有两个第1名时接下来仍然跟着第2名;c)row_number()是连续排序,并且有并
fw0124
·
2020-07-27 22:46
Oracle
SQL Server 2012大幅增强T-SQL支持分页
SQLServer2012对T-SQL进行了大幅增强,其中包括支持ANSIFIRST_VALUE和
LAST_VALUE
函数,支持使用FETCH与OFFSET进行声明式数据分页,以及支持.NET中的解析与格式化函数
VS_URL
·
2020-07-27 17:45
SQLSERVER
Oracle SQL 分析函数 first、last、first_value、
last_value
、nth_value
--数据库版本SEAN@sean>select*fromv$version;BANNER--------------------------------------------------------------------------------OracleDatabase11gEnterpriseEditionRelease11.2.0.4.0-64bitProductionPL/SQLRel
SeanData
·
2020-07-27 17:21
Oracle
开发
Oracle
性能优化
Hive分析窗口函数一(LAG,LEAD,FIRST_VALUE,
LAST_VALUE
)
数据准备:cookie1,2015-04-1010:00:02,url2cookie1,2015-04-1010:00:00,url1cookie1,2015-04-1010:03:04,1url3cookie1,2015-04-1010:50:05,url6cookie1,2015-04-1011:00:00,url7cookie1,2015-04-1010:10:00,url4cookie1,
小小程序员凉凉
·
2020-07-27 14:42
大数据-Hive
分析函数--FIRST_VALUE,
LAST_VALUE
,LAG,LEAD,ROW_NUMBER
一,FIRST_VALUE,LAST_VALUER的使用1,FIRST_VALUE是指返回组中数据窗口的第一个值2,
LAST_VALUE
是指返回组中数据窗口的最后一个值(注意点:不受排序的影响,后面发现是因为没有开窗导致的
yjyiuje
·
2020-07-27 14:31
分析函数
Hive分析窗口函数(四) LAG、LEAD、FIRST_VALUE和
LAST_VALUE
数据cookie4.txtcookie1,2015-04-1010:00:02,url2cookie1,2015-04-1010:00:00,url1cookie1,2015-04-1010:03:04,1url3cookie1,2015-04-1010:50:05,url6cookie1,2015-04-1011:00:00,url7cookie1,2015-04-1010:10:00,url4
任何忧伤都抵不过世界的美丽
·
2020-07-27 13:38
hive
oracle
last_value
使用过程中的一个细节
测试结果集:selectrole_id,update_datefromuser_infowhererole_id='6505007898843021313'使用
last_value
求出当前role_id
weixin_30932215
·
2020-07-27 13:16
greenplum窗口函数使用浅析
每天列出TOP10COSTTIMEJOB进行分析,其中TOP1COSTTIMEJOB采用了窗口函数first_value和
last_value
,结果SQL全部使用的是first_value,并且为了全部使用
weixin_30556959
·
2020-07-27 13:24
Hive分析窗口函数(四) LAG,LEAD,FIRST_VALUE,
LAST_VALUE
继续学习这四个分析函数。注意:这几个函数不支持WINDOW子句。(什么是WINDOW子句,点此查看前面的文章)Hive版本为apache-hive-0.13.1数据准备:cookie1,2015-04-1010:00:02,url2cookie1,2015-04-1010:00:00,url1cookie1,2015-04-1010:03:04,1url3cookie1,2015-04-1010:
快乐与忧郁的码农
·
2020-07-27 13:50
hive
Oracle返回指定列首行或末行值之FIRST_VALUE与
LAST_VALUE
FIRST_VALUE与
LAST_VALUE
功能:返回指定列首行值和末行值在语法上有9i和10g和区别:9i:FIRST_VALUE(expr)OVER(analytic_clause)10g:FIRST_VALUE
元松2918
·
2020-07-27 13:17
软件研发
DB/SQL/NoSQL
JavaEE/Java
C#/.net
hive ---求行差值案例---判断行值是否相等案例 【lag, lead, frist_value,
last_value
】的使用案例
假设有表goods(日期,产品id,产品当日收入,产品当日成本),日期和产品id是组合主键,有若干条数据,日期范围2016年1月1日至今,且一定每个产品,每天都有数据写出SQL实现如下要求:数据文件:goods.txt数据:2018-03-01,a,3000,25002018-03-01,b,4000,32002018-03-01,c,3200,24002018-03-01,d,3000,2500
iQian²
·
2020-07-27 12:20
hive
oracle 分析函数 FIRST_VALUE、
LAST_VALUE
FIRST_VALUE、
LAST_VALUE
是两个分析函数。返回结果集中排在第一位和最后一位的值。
feier7501
·
2020-07-27 11:41
oracle
【分析函数】使用分析函数
LAST_VALUE
或11g LAG实现缺失数据填充及其区别
转载自:http://blog.chinaunix.net/uid-7655508-id-3736949.html在“使用PartitionedOuterJoin实现稠化报表”这篇文章中,讲述了实现稠化数据填充的方法。这篇文章和上述文章有所不同,主要讲述实现对指定的空行,按照前面非空或后面非空数据进行填充。原来这种实现数据填充的方法,主要是用LAST_VALUE+IGNORENULLS(10g)实
编程小强
·
2020-07-27 11:35
Oracle开发
sql server前值填充
2、oracle实现前值填充3、sqlserver实现前值填充4、sqlserver中的first_value、
last_value
函数怎么用?
craftsman2020
·
2020-07-27 10:33
SQL
Server
sqlserver
sql
oracle
[Hive]窗口函数LEAD LAG FIRST_VALUE
LAST_VALUE
窗口函数(windowfunctions)对多行进行操作,并为查询中的每一行返回一个值。OVER()子句能将窗口函数与其他分析函数(analyticalfunctions)和报告函数(reportingfunctions)区分开来。1.常用窗口函数下表列出了一些窗口函数以及描述信息:窗口函数描述LAG()LAG()窗口函数返回分区中当前行之前行(可以指定第几行)的值。如果没有行,则返回null。L
SunnyYoona
·
2020-07-14 23:25
Hive
hive窗口函数之ntile、lag、lead、first_value、
last_value
目录1.样例数据2.ntile(n)2.1实例3.lag、lead、first_value、last_value3.1实例3.1.1问题1:如果想取分组后pv最后一个值3.1.2问题2:如果不排序会怎样?其他窗口函数可翻看:窗口函数之(sum、avg、max、min)窗口函数之(row_number,rank,dense_rank)1.样例数据idcrtimepvcookie1,2015-04-1
MicoOu
·
2020-07-14 05:19
Hive
MySQL高级窗口函数简介
高级窗口函数窗口函数在复杂查询以及数据仓库中应用得比较频繁与sql打交道比较多的技术人员都需要掌握文章目录一.row_number、rank、dense_rank二.lag、lead三.first_value、
last_value
只是甲
·
2020-07-13 14:30
Mysql开发
SQL中分析函数first_value(),
last_value
,sum() over(partition by...)详解
SQL中分析函数first_value(),
last_value
,sum()over(partitionby…)详解首先,生成有一张原始表score,s_id表示学生id,c_id表示课程id,s_core
奥卡姆的剃刀
·
2020-07-10 13:13
SQL
窗口函数使用
窗口可以与下面这些函数结合使用:sum(),avg(),max(),min(),count(),variance()和stddev();窗口也可以和first_value()与
last_value
()结合使用
wanglipo
·
2020-07-10 05:27
oracle分析函数
分析函数first、last、first_value、
last_value
FIRST和LAST函数功能:获取首行和尾行(可以有并列的情况)的非排序字段的值语法:aggregate_functionKEEP(DENSE_RANK{FIRST|LAST}ORDERBYexpr[DESC|ASC][NULLSFIRST|LAST])OVER(query_partition_clause)使用说明:①first和last函数有over子句就是分析函数,没有就是聚合函数。②函数的
sctrkb
·
2020-07-10 01:43
ORACLE
last_Value
函数的使用(SQL SERVER 2012RC)
时常,我们想取回最值记录,比如,最后日期什么的,看一个例子,ifOBJECT_ID('test','u')isnotnulldroptabletestgocreatetabletest(Idint,Namenvarchar(50),Datedate,Amountint)goinsertintotest(Id,Name,Date,Amount)values(1,'张三','2011-01-22',1
iteye_6233
·
2020-07-09 17:14
分析函数:first_value,
last_value
用法
分析函数:first_value,
last_value
用法2009-07-0311:09:38|分类:技术类|举报|字号订阅下载LOFTER我的照片书|原始数据:SQL>select*froma;NONAMESCOTT
javaPie
·
2020-07-09 15:30
Oracle
分析函数——FIRST_VALUE()和
LAST_VALUE
()
FIRST_VALUE()和
LAST_VALUE
()字面意思已经很直观了,取首尾记录值。
cuituancheng9378
·
2020-07-09 15:00
Oracle 高级查询之二 分析函数部分--first_value,
last_value
ORACLE函数:
LAST_VALUE
,FIRST_VALUE的用法:1、初始化原始数据:createtabletest(idnumber(2),namevarchar2(10),salarynumber
congjiong5980
·
2020-07-09 14:24
Oracle分析函数-first_value()和
last_value
()
first_value()和
last_value
()字面意思已经很直观了,取首尾记录值。
风神修罗使
·
2020-07-09 12:33
Oracle数据库
【Oracle】分析函数first、last、first_value、
last_value
FIRST和LAST函数功能:获取首行和尾行(可以有并列的情况)的非排序字段的值语法:aggregate_functionKEEP(DENSE_RANK{FIRST|LAST}ORDERBYexpr[DESC|ASC][NULLSFIRST|LAST])OVER(query_partition_clause)使用说明:①first和last函数有over子句就是分析函数,没有就是聚合函数。②函数的
结渔
·
2020-07-09 12:56
Database
分析函数——first_value()与
last_value
()
问题的提出:在使用first_value()或
last_value
()的时候,同时使用partition和orderby会得不到想要的效果。
cryangel8023
·
2020-07-09 07:57
Postgresql使用函数初始化所有索引初始值
:仅适合从其他库导出结构并需要序列初始化时使用select*from序列值名称(Exp:user_id_seq);ALTERSEQUENCEuser_id_seqrestartwith4;实际修改的是
last_value
cleancp
·
2020-07-07 05:44
工作
上一页
1
2
3
4
下一页
按字母分类:
A
B
C
D
E
F
G
H
I
J
K
L
M
N
O
P
Q
R
S
T
U
V
W
X
Y
Z
其他